Abstract
This fact sheet summarizes the information in the RED document for reregistration case 2055, bis(trichloromethyl)sulfone. bis(trichloromethyl)sulfone is used to control microbes, algae, and fungi in cooling water systems, waste disposal systems, pulp and paper mill water systems, oil extraction systems, and other industrial settings (adhesives, industrial coatings, industrial emulsions, etc.). Formulations include soluble concentrated liquids, ready-to-use liquids, and soluble concentrated solids. These products are added to systems and industrial products using pouring and pumping methods.
